The Singer Stories. Journey among the Cantastorie of Puglia

"Le storie cantante. Journey among the Cantastorie of Puglia" is a documentary that forms part of a broader research project developed by the authors, tracing the roots of Apulian musical tradition—both written and oral. The journey begins with the imagined arrival of Aeneas on the shores of Porto Badisco. The path is shaped by the testimonies of singers of Southern identity, from Uccio Aloisi to Tonino Zurlo, from Enzo Del Re to the choral ensemble Cantori di Carpino, concluding with Matteo Salvatore. Alongside these performer-authors—cantastorie who can be seen as forerunners of modern singer-songwriters (as in the case of Salvatore)—stand contributions from ethnomusicologist and musician Antonio Infantino, director, actor and writer Moni Ovadia, Neapolitan jazz musician Daniele Sepe, and director and actor Michele Placido.
